Transaction 8830887272faf789f98498d5c407798bd33bb9e3610ad8529b22d695d88f9b14
2 Input
2 Outputs
- 8830887272faf789f98498d5c407798bd33bb9e3610ad8529b22d695d88f9b14:0
- 8830887272faf789f98498d5c407798bd33bb9e3610ad8529b22d695d88f9b14:1
value 2000000
address 18WpdrHm2wjVPwnpUFHDXGzwcYAwp7yvVw
value 12787414
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n